Guest IrskasMom Posted June 19, 2010 Share Posted June 19, 2010 I have a Friend in the UK who always picks up the unwanted from the Kennel . Stevie was on of them. The Owner brought him to the Kennel and said :" I don't want him anymore ,you can have him.Well, the ultimate Betrayal for this poor old Boy. Today had Stevie's suffering an End.Stevie died today. " I'm sad to say that Stevie passed on today. He was going down hill so much, especially this week, I had him put to sleep at 10.45 A.M. Stevie was a dog that never complained and it was hard to tell just how much pain he was in. He fell over coming through my back door and hit his head, and then groaned when I helped him up. Poor, poor Stevie, 14 years and 8 months old and to all intents and purposes a long life, but sadly so much of it wasted living the lonely life of a kennel dog. At the end of this month he would have been with me two years, two years of living as a pet dog instead of an inmate of a canine prison. Quite honestly he deserved more, and would have had more if I had known earlier he needed a home. Well Stevie has gone, but just how many Stevie's are out there living out their life in a kennel instead of languishing on someone's couch. Let's hope there is such a place as "The Rainbow Bridge" where we will meet all our doggy friends again. Aglish Steve 1-10-1995------19-06-2010.
